Renting out my shed as a warehouse.

With the new house that we bought last year there is a big garage/shed at the side of it. A great addition to any house.

Anyway, with the new contract that we are after getting at work things have gotten very busy and we are really burning through supplies at twice the rate that we were before.

The boss only has limited storage in his own shed and we are finding it hard to keep enough stock for our weekly jobs with the main supplier inside the city it is very time consuming to pick up any extra bits and he can only deliver so much at a time to the boss's shed.

He had talked about renting a couple of storage containers at his house to hold extra stock so i offered him an alternative.

My house is at the opposite side of the area that we cover to his shed and the main supplier. I said that it could be handy to have supplies down this side of the area so that we didn't have to keep traveling up his side for every job to re supply.

Since i always have a work van at my house anyway i said it would be great to have supplies here and be able to stock the van in the mornings for jobs in this area. We could hold a lot of stock in my shed and we could cut down on travelling for all of us.

He said it was worth a try for a few months and see it it would work for a fair rental rate.

Finding those win win situations.

  • The boss gets additional storage.
  • We have to spend less time travelling for supplies.
  • Reduces his operating costs.
  • I have to do less miles every week for the same amount of work.
  • I get a top up to my wages for extra space that i have.
  • We can complete more work on a monthly basis which means more money for the company.

The only downside is i lose some storage space but i have plenty more for my own needs. This won't last forever but if i can get a couple of years from it then it's brilliant. Every euro in life is hard earned so anytime that you can make some easier euros then it's a bonus.
